Columbia Plateau Trail - Access Points

Access Points

Proceeding from the northeast toward the southwest, major access points include:

  • Fishlake trailhead – Milepost 365
  • Cheney Trailhead – Milepost 361.25
  • Amber Lake Trailhead – Milestone 349.25
  • Martin Road Trailhead – Milestone 342
  • Lamont Trailhead
  • John Wayne Pioneer Trail intersection (no trailhead)
  • Benge Trailhead
  • Washtucna Trailhead (Trail Administrative Area in downtown Washtucna)
  • Kahlotus Trailhead & Visitor Center 46°38′41.77″N 118°33′17.67″W / 46.6449361°N 118.5549083°W / 46.6449361; -118.5549083
  • Snake River Junction Trailhood
  • Ice Harbor Dam Trailhead 46°14′58″N 118°52′46″W / 46.24944°N 118.87944°W / 46.24944; -118.87944
  • Sacajawea State Park Pasco
